About this ebook

For Jason Graham, the world ends not with a bang, not even with much of a whimper.

One second, he's sitting in a restaurant in Mobile, Alabama, chatting with a server, the next he finds himself in a strange room, rescued by mysterious alien benefactors. Seems the world did end, though how and why are something of a mystery.

Now, Jason—and five hundred million other humans—are in orbit around an Earthlike world that is abundant in natural resources and totally untamed. For the newly awakened humans, this is a chance to start society with a clean slate and a bright future. For Jason, who has knocked about aimlessly in several different careers in his Earth life, it’s an opportunity to unleash his creativity and ambition and see what he can really do.

Have you ever wondered what it would be like if John Ringo novelized the first ten minutes of an RTS game? He makes resource gathering as exciting as it can be. Far less combat than most John Ringo books, and it definitely gets into the weeds a bit with all the focus on hunting and gathering, but it's still an enjoyable read. It almost feels like the first quarter of a much larger book—I chalk this up to a noticeable lack of a "big bad" antagonist. I will be picking up the next one, no questions there. Recommended read for anyone familiar with John's books...just don't expect the Posleen to turn up, at least in this book.

About the author

John Ringo is the New York Times best-selling author of the Black Tide Rising series, the Posleen War series, the Through the Looking Glass series, and more, including the Troy Rising series, of which Live Free or Die is the first installment. A veteran of the 82nd Airborne, Ringo brings firsthand knowledge of military operations to his fiction.
